What to Bring to your Appointment:
-
Required: All taxpayers must be present with photo identification
-
Required: Original Social Security Cards or ITINs for tax filers and dependents
-
Last year’s tax return (tax year 2022)
-
W-2 from your job/employer
-
Total Cash income & 1099 Misc from a Job or Uber, Lyft, Postmates, etc.
-
VITA: Business expenses are limited to $20,000
-
-
1099 G from EDD/Unemployment
-
1099 R from Retirement Income
-
1099 SSA from Social Security Administration (Not SSI)
-
1099 INT for Interest income (savings or bank account)
-
1099 DIV from Dividends
-
W-2 G from Gambling
-
Form 1095A for health insurance purchased through Covered CA
-
(We do not need 1095B nor 1095C)
-
-
Identity Protection Personal Identification Number (IP PIN) issued by the IRS
-
Bank account number for fast and secure direct deposit of your refund.
Forms for credits and deductions:
-
Self-Employment Deductions: Receipts & invoices related to self-employment; and total mileage for car deduction
-
Education Credit: Form 1098T Tuition form for you or anyone on the return attending college
-
Education Credit: Complete tuition and financial aid statements, and/or receipts for required textbooks, technology, and software.
-
Note: Housing, parking, and food is not included in the Education Credit.
-
-
Form 1098E Interest paid on Student Loans
-
Form 1098 Mortgage and Property Tax
-
Donations over $500 require a letter
-
Medical expenses: Receipts
-
Child Care credit: Name, Address, Social # and Phone Number of your Child Care provider
-
ITIN Applications & Renewals: valid photo identification and birth certificate OR a valid passport.​

Returns that are considered Out-of-Scope:
-
Incomes more than $60,000
-
Married Filing Separately returns (If you are legally married & file alone - you may be a Married Filing Separate taxpayer - this is out of scope and we will not be able to assist you).
-
Self-employed or cash income with:
-
Taking expenses with no proof (receipts, documented mileage, etc. are required)
-
Business related expenses over $20,000
-
Have a loss
-
Businesses with employees, inventory, or business property.
-
-
Returns for companies and/or businesses
-
Cancelled debt income (Forms 1099C and 1099A) for foreclosures or short sales.
-
Handwritten tax documents (W-2, 1099, 1098, etc.)
-
Returns for visitors, such as “F,” “J,” “M,” or “Q” visas, that require a 1040NR tax return.
-
Foreign Income
-
Royalty Income
-
Partnership or income from an LLC (Form K-1)
-
Returns with the sale of stocks with more than 20 sales.
-
Returns with sale of cryptocurrencies.
-
Returns with AirBNB rental income.
Forms that WE DO NOT NEED:
-
Supplemental Security Income (SSI)
-
Child Support
-
Veterans Benefit
-
Life insurance when someone passes
-
Settlements not related to a job or employment
-
CalFresh or food assistance
-
CalWorks or welfare cash assistance from the county
-
Inheritance, gifts, or bequests
-
Alimony for divorces after 2018
-
Money from a scholarship is not taxable. However, if you use the money for room and board, or use it to pay other personal expenses, that portion is normally taxable.
-
Health insurance from an employer or county (Forms 1095B and 1095C)
These are not taxable
